Class java.io.FilterReader
All Packages Class Hierarchy This Package Previous Next Index
Class java.io.FilterReader
java.lang.Object
|
+----java.io.Reader
|
+----java.io.FilterReader
public abstract class FilterReader
extends Reader
Abstract class for reading filtered character streams.
in
The underlying character-input stream, or null if the stream has been
closed
FilterReader(Reader)
Create a new filtered reader.
close()
Close the stream.
mark(int)
Mark the present position in the stream.
markSupported()
Tell whether this stream supports the mark() operation.
read()
Read a single character.
read(char[], int, int)
Read characters into a portion of an array.
ready()
Tell whether this stream is ready to be read.
reset()
Reset the stream.
skip(long)
Skip characters.
in
protected Reader in
The underlying character-input stream, or null if the stream has been
closed
FilterReader
protected FilterReader(Reader in)
Create a new filtered reader.
read
public int read() throws IOException
Read a single character.
Throws: IOException
If an I/O error occurs
Overrides:
read in class Reader
read
public int read(char cbuf[],
int off,
int len) throws IOException
Read characters into a portion of an array.
Throws: IOException
If an I/O error occurs
Overrides:
read in class Reader
skip
public long skip(long n) throws IOException
Skip characters.
Throws: IOException
If an I/O error occurs
Overrides:
skip in class Reader
ready
public boolean ready() throws IOException
Tell whether this stream is ready to be read.
Throws: IOException
If an I/O error occurs
Overrides:
ready in class Reader
markSupported
public boolean markSupported()
Tell whether this stream supports the mark() operation.
Overrides:
markSupported in class Reader
mark
public void mark(int readAheadLimit) throws IOException
Mark the present position in the stream.
Throws: IOException
If an I/O error occurs
Overrides:
mark in class Reader
reset
public void reset() throws IOException
Reset the stream.
Throws: IOException
If an I/O error occurs
Overrides:
reset in class Reader
close
public void close() throws IOException
Close the stream.
Throws: IOException
If an I/O error occurs
Overrides:
close in class Reader
All Packages Class Hierarchy This Package Previous Next Index
Submit a bug or feature - Version 1.1.7 of Java Platform API Specification
Java is a trademark or registered trademark of Sun Microsystems, Inc. in the US and other countries.
Copyright 1995-1998 Sun Microsystems, Inc. 901 San Antonio Road,
Palo Alto, California, 94303, U.S.A. All Rights Reserved.
Wyszukiwarka
Podobne podstrony:
java io FilterInputStreamjava io FilterOutputStreamjava io FilterWriterjava io InvalidClassExceptionjava io SyncFailedExceptionjava io SequenceInputStreamjava io BufferedInputStreamjava io BufferedWriterjava io PushbackInputStreamjava io BufferedOutputStreamjava io InvalidObjectExceptionjava io FileDescriptorjava io ObjectInputStreamjava io ObjectOutputStreamjava io StreamTokenizerjava io PipedReaderjava io ObjectOutputjava io OutputStreamjava io PrintWriterwięcej podobnych podstron